Overview
Gratitude, a 2017 Azimut 72, is an exceptional luxury motor yacht that artfully unites strength, agility, and refinement. Ideal for day cruising or long-range passages, this flybridge yacht promises an elevated experience underway. Twin V12 MAN engines and zero‑speed gyro stabilizers provide poised, quiet performance and unwavering comfort in every sea state—true performance yacht pedigree.
Designed for extended cruising, she features a watermaker, hydraulic swim platform, and an expansive flybridge crafted for relaxation and entertainment. Multiple lounging, dining, and conversation areas complement a bright, contemporary layout. The main deck flows from an aft salon to a centerline galley with a dedicated dining nook and forward interior helm, while below, four staterooms—each with a private ensuite—ensure restful accommodations. Crew quarters are accessed to port from the transom and include two berths with thoughtful storage.
The flybridge is a signature space—open, airy, and fully appointed for everything from casual afternoons to refined soirées. Highlights include a retractable sunroof, surround‑sound audio, overhead and deck lighting, multiple seating zones, a high‑gloss dining table for eight, an additional forward dinette, and a full wet bar with sink, refrigerator, ice maker, and Kenyon grill/cooktop. A custom removable Isinglass enclosure enhances comfort in bright sun or breezy conditions—hallmarks of a true flybridge motor yacht.
On the aft deck, guests discover another inviting social hub with a high‑gloss dining table, built‑in seating, and a raised portside wet bar with sink and refrigerator. Wide sliders open to the salon, and a starboard aft docking station with throttles plus bow/stern thruster controls makes close‑quarters maneuvering effortless—bluewater cruiser confidence with superyacht style.
The bow is equally captivating and a favorite from sunrise to starlight. Expansive forward sun pads invite sunbathing, while a second social zone with U‑shaped seating, table, and a sun canopy creates a private terrace for conversation and panoramic views—an iconic touch for a Mediterranean‑inspired cruising yacht.
Inside, the salon is luminous, modern, and elegantly detailed, framed by sweeping windows and multiple seating groupings. Finishes include hardwood soles, a leather sofa with coffee table, a loveseat, a built‑in glass cabinet for spirits and stemware, and a TV. The portside center galley features light quartz countertops, a raised serving ledge, full‑height refrigerator, dishwasher, Miele cooktop, microwave/convection oven, and abundant stowage. To starboard, the dining area offers custom bench seating. Forward, the lower helm presents dual Raymarine displays, bow and stern thrusters, primary controls, VHF, and a comprehensive suite of monitoring gauges.
Below, four beautifully crafted staterooms—each with an ensuite—provide the privacy and comfort expected of a premium cruising yacht.
The full‑beam owner’s suite aft is serene and sophisticated, dressed in soft ivory hues with rich wood accents. Appointments include a king berth, built‑in dresser, full‑length mirrored wardrobe, oversized windows, a semi‑transparent mirror TV, nightstands, reading lights, a seating area with table, plush carpeting, and an ensuite with dual sinks, marble counters, a glass walk‑in shower, porthole, mirrored cabinetry, and generous under‑sink storage.
Forward, the VIP features a raised queen berth, overhead lockers, twin nightstands, built‑in shelving, two closets, skylights, Samsung TV, rectangular hull windows with opening port, soft carpeting, and an ensuite with a glass walk‑in shower, marble vanity, mirrored cabinet, and porthole—true luxury cruiser comfort.
The port guest cabin offers a full‑size berth, large window with opening port, spacious wardrobe, nightstand, reading lights, television, and an ensuite with a glass walk‑in shower featuring a seat and window. To starboard, the guest cabin provides twin side‑by‑side berths, a shared nightstand, reading lights, a window with opening port, and an ensuite with a glass walk‑in shower with seat and window—versatile accommodations for family or guests on a planing motor yacht built for style and range.
